Thanks for the post. Our two favorite times of year for Sequoia are the middle of winter, and early-mid spring (April-early May). Very few people and the park is larger than Yosemite:

http://www.guidetomilitarytravel.com...onal-Park.html

A few great recs in this article imo, especially the lights out at Crystal Cave. Amazing experience, and all they do is turn the lights off in the cave for 30 seconds.
